1. What is personal data?

 

The term “personal data” refers to any information from which a person can be identified, directly or indirectly. This concerns the data that belongs to a person. For example, name, address, zip code, place of residence, telephone number, e-mail address or a photo.

 

The processing of personal data is governed by the General Data Protection Regulation (EU) 2016/679 (hereinafter: “GDPR”) that entered into force on 25 May 2018.

10. What are your rights?

 

Subject to exemptions (under the GDPR), you have the following rights with regard to your personal data:

 

The right to request information about the processing of your personal data;

The right to have your personal data transferred to another party (data portability);

The right to change your personal data;

The right to withdraw your consent;

The right to have your data deleted if the data is no longer necessary for the purposes for which it was obtained or if you withdraw your consent.

The right to restriction of processing;

The right to object to the processing;

The right to file a complaint with the Dutch Data Protection Authority if you believe that Jane Lushka is acting in violation of the applicable privacy rules.
